Output c8d81ddd5f4c5dc5251009e5b66bd5f515b83e802e1f7e16553335d682ad560e:0

value
2034965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 145569948fb21c873e9e8102f244b42ff51d21f8 OP_EQUAL
address
33YXkwSw78huE3wgEWr7JyWnCWJKPjJrhg
transaction
c8d81ddd5f4c5dc5251009e5b66bd5f515b83e802e1f7e16553335d682ad560e
spent
true